I redeemed myself a bit last weekend by going 3-1.

Didn't I tell you that Missouri would be a spoiler, and that there wouldn't be an undefeated team in the National Championship game.

So another weekend that saw the two top teams toppled and now we have Missouri and West Virginia ranked 1 and 2, which very well may change depending on the outcome of the "Big 12" championship game.

There aren't very many games to handicap, and some of the ones that are being played are the traditional intrastate rivalries, which can be tricky because of all the emotion that permeates these games.

But we have to go with what we have so let's give California, away, minus 13, over Stanford, and keep our fingers crossed.

I'll pick Rutgers, away, plus 3, over Louisville, and, in a pick-um, I'll take Oregon over Oregon State.

Finally, I'll try Arizona State, at home, minus 7, over Arizona.
